Transaction

09dfe992edd7376c8bc29101cb82c7980063315e8a2eeaa163ff384ec6de17fd
295,985 confirmations
Timestamp
1594328621
Block638,507
Fee19,448 sats
Fee rate52.3 sats/vB
view on mempool.space

Inputs & Outputs